Transaction 3acdd783db397d85ad1a405edbd35931e847a79e1771d0b7e089a5ba1f80353b

1 Input
2 Outputs
  • 3acdd783db397d85ad1a405edbd35931e847a79e1771d0b7e089a5ba1f80353b:0
  • value  28609553
    address  16aCDhV71Us2poWPG7SkYTQfbmDN2vCKwG
  • 3acdd783db397d85ad1a405edbd35931e847a79e1771d0b7e089a5ba1f80353b:1
  • value  100514982
    address  1MftgXSdaE9UUpCyc3EavVb8gERxMgk5Wz